Sheen Changes Name For Upcoming Film "Machete Kills"

 

Sheen changes name for new film. Since his first Hollywood movie, Red Dawn, actor Charlie Sheen has has used his "American Name" for every film or TV role that he's ever been in. But he's using his birth name and embracing his Latino heritage for his new film "Machete Kills." He's using his birth name, Carlos Estevez, for his billing in the new film.

The Estevez/Sheen name history is long as it is complicated. His father, Martin Sheen, was originally born as Ramon Antonio Gerardo Estevez. He only decided to change his name to Martin Sheen in order to have a better chance to be a US actor. But, he never officially and legally changed his name. This led to all four of his children to adopt his legl last name, Estevez. His son Charlie Sheen kept his original name until he also wanted to become an actor. At that time, he changed his to match that of his father's.

But now, for the first time in his long acting career, Sheen uses his birth name. This is most likely to fit in with his latino costars on the film. Carlos Estevez joins an all-star cast, with Danny Trejo, Amber Heard, Mel Gibson, Sofia Vergara, Jessica Alba, Michelle Rodriguez, Antonio Banderas, Cuba Gooding Jr., and more.
